CAS 17544-07-9
:N-Isopropylpyrrolidine
Description:
N-Isopropylpyrrolidine is a cyclic amine characterized by its five-membered ring structure, which includes a nitrogen atom. This compound features an isopropyl group attached to the nitrogen, contributing to its unique properties. It is a colorless to pale yellow liquid at room temperature and has a relatively low boiling point. N-Isopropylpyrrolidine is known for its moderate polarity and can act as a solvent or reagent in various chemical reactions. Its molecular structure allows for potential applications in organic synthesis, particularly in the production of p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als. Additionally, it exhibits basic properties due to the presence of the nitrogen atom, making it capable of forming salts with acids. Safety considerations should be taken into account when handling this compound, as it may pose health risks if inhaled or ingested. Overall, N-Isopropylpyrrolidine is a versatile chemical with significant relevance in both industrial and research settings.
